* About the Role:

*
* Join CBRE as a Union Mobile HVAC Engineer supporting a dynamic retail portfolio across the CT area. In this hands-on role, you'll keep buildings running at their best by performing preventive maintenance and responding to service requests across multiple sites.

Day-to-day, you'll operate, inspect, troubleshoot, and repair HVAC, mechanical, electrical, plumbing, and other building systems-helping ensure a safe, comfortable experience for clients and customers while minimizing downtime.

Best part? You start your day from home and head straight to your assigned sites in a fully equipped  
** CBRE company van-complete with gas card, tools, technology, and uniforms provided** . No office check-ins, no extra stops, just get on the road and get the job done.

*
* Key Responsibilities:

*
* + Perform preventive maintenance and respond to repair work orders for building systems and equipment.

+ Inspect, operate, and maintain HVAC, electrical, plumbing, and general building systems.

+ Conduct facility inspections and report conditions impacting operations.

+ Troubleshoot and repair equipment while maintaining safety and efficiency standards.

+ Follow all safety procedures, complete hazard assessments, and comply with OSHA and local regulations.

+ Use CMMS (e.g., Corrigo) to update work orders and document activities in real time.

+ Communicate effectively with clients and management; work independently in the field.

+ Safely operate and maintain company vehicles; complete required inspections and documentation.

*
* Qualifications:

*
* + High school diploma or equivalent; trade school or apprenticeship preferred.

+ 3-5 years of experience in building engineering (HVAC, electrical, plumbing).

+ Strong troubleshooting and diagnostic skills.

+ EPA Universal Certification required.

+ Valid driver's license required

+ Ability to read blueprints and wiring diagrams.
